Details
A vulnerability classified as critical has been found in bson up to 0.7. This affects the function bson_ensure_space. The manipulation of the argument bytesNeeded with an unknown input leads to a integer overflow v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-190. The product performs a calculation that can produce an integer overflow or wraparound, when the logic assumes that the resulting value will always be larger than the original value. This can introduce other weaknesses when the calculation is used for resource management or execution control.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The summary by CVE is:
bson before 0.8 incorrectly uses int rather than size_t for many variables, parameters, and return values. In particular, the bson_ensure_space() parameter bytesNeeded could have an integer overflow via properly constructed bson input.
The weakness was released 04/24/2020.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2020-12135 since 04/24/2020.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. No form of authentication is needed for exploitation. It demands that the victim is doing some kind of user interaction. Technical details are known, but no exploit is available.
Upgrading to version 0.8 eliminates this vulnerability.
